We the people ask the federal government to Propose a new Administration policy:

Make a National Hate Crime Registry Mandatory for Convicted Hate Crime Offenders

Created by E.F. on November 16, 2016

Require convicted Hate Crime Offenders to register on a National Hate Crime Registry.
People found guilty of committing Hate Crimes pose a potential threat to the communities in which they reside, and to any community in which they may later reside. Community members have the right to know if such an offender is living in the community for their safety and welfare.
